【ChatGPT】チャットが長くなるとAIの回答品質が低下する理由とは?

近年、ChatGPTをはじめとする対話型AIが普及し、仕事やプライベートで活用される機会が増えています。
しかし、実際に長時間使用していると「最初は良かったのに、途中から回答の精度が落ちた」と感じた経験はないでしょうか。

この記事では、その原因と内部で何が起きているのかについて、わかりやすく解説いたします。

目次

チャットが長くなると回答品質が劣化する理由

AIは会話をする際、「チャット履歴」を内部で一定量だけ保持しています。
この内部保持の仕組みは「コンテキストメモリ」あるいは「トークン制御」と呼ばれています。

ここでいうトークンとは、文章を細かく分解した「単語」や「文字列の断片」を指し、AIはこのトークン単位で情報を管理しています。

しかし、AIには「保持できるトークンの上限」が設定されています。
上限を超えると、古い会話内容から順に自動的に忘れていく仕組みになっています。

これを専門用語では「コンテキストウィンドウのオーバーフロー」と呼びます。

その結果、

  • 初期に指示した重要なルール
  • 会話の前提となる条件
  • 丁寧な話し方や細かい好み

などが徐々に薄れ、回答が雑になったり、意図からズレた内容になったりしてしまうのです。

なぜ無限に記憶できないのか?

「忘れずにすべて記憶していてくれればいいのに」と思われるかもしれません。
しかし、もしAIが無制限に情報を記憶し続けると、次のような問題が起きます。

  • 処理速度の低下
  • メモリ消費量の急増による暴走リスク

このため、AIには安全管理のためにトークン上限が設けられているのです。
これは特定のユーザーに対して意図的に悪くしているわけではなく、すべての対話型AIに共通した設計上の制約となっています。

回答品質低下を防ぐための対策

完全な防止は難しいですが、次のような工夫をすることで劣化をある程度抑えることができます。

  • 会話を適度に区切る
     →チャットを一度終了し、新しい会話を始める。
  • 重要なルールや指示をリマインドする
     →途中であらためて再提示する。
  • 要点をコンパクトにまとめる
     →トークン消費を抑えるため、不要な長文を避ける。

これらを意識することで、AIとのやり取りをより安定させることができるでしょう。

まとめ

長時間のチャットによる回答品質の低下は、コンテキストメモリの限界に起因するものです。
この仕組みを理解したうえで、適切に会話を管理することが、AIをより効果的に活用するコツとなります。

今後、AI技術はさらに進化していくでしょうが、現状ではこうした制約があることを知っておくと、よりストレスなく利用できるはずです。

よ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

私が勉強したこと、実践したこと、してることを書いているブログです。
主に資産運用について書いていたのですが、
最近はプログラミングに興味があるので、今はそればっかりです。

目次